Identification and source apportionment of trace elements in urban and suburban area of Ankara
Goli, Tayebeh; Tuncel, Süleyman Gürdal; Aslan Kılavuz, Seda; Department of Environmental Engineering (2017)
In this study, Chemistry and Composition of Atmospheric fine aerosol particles in urban and suburban stations in Ankara are identified and generated data set are used to determine sources of fine particles, using receptor modeling. For this purpose, 24- hr aerosol samples were collected on Nuclepore filters using a ‘Stack Filter Unit’. Sampling continued for 15 months from July 2014 to October 2015.
